Afterburner Vortex's are nice but have you seen this group buy?
That exhaust is manufactured by the same people that make the Vortex (Hayward & Scott) and is virtually identical bar a different baffle design in the Vortex. See the official group buy thread on SIDC for more details. It's fraction of the cost of the Vortex at the group buy price too!
There's some sound bites of the Vortex on the Scooby World website to give you an idea of noise. It, along with the H&S Jap Style exhaust, are around the 105-110dB level depending on whether or not you have a de-cat already.
